Local sportsmen are out deer hunting or into some Duck hunting. With the cooler weather and shorter days the bigger bucks should be moving during the day. January 1st. & the close of another Deer Season is approaching. For the Fisherman, the coastal creeks around Edisto Island are great for lots of action. Spottail bass are hitting on mud minnows and cut mullet worked near live oyster beds on the falling tide. Also fish the deep holes on low tide. In the three local rivers, it’s a great time to fish for bass, catfish and crappie. Bass can be caught on Texas rigged worms and small crankbaits fished close to structure near the bank. The catfish can be caught in deep holes in the rivers using live and cut bait. Some crappie can be caught using minnows.

It’s that time of year for some great Spottail Bass fish’n now that the waters have cooled down & cleared up. Look for the Spottail Bass to be schooling in the flats, trying to stay in warmer water. A sharp eye will spot them "Finning" in the flats. Try a spoon tipped with a mud minnow & work it very slowly. The fish are very lethargic just as we are in the cold. It’s a good time for gigging for flounder as the water is much clearer this time of year. The Spots & Whiting fish’n has been great & Flounder are being taken on live shrimp, mud minnows & fingerling mullet.
